Doug Umbehauer, Sr. boasts nearly 40 years of professional painting and wallpaper installation experience. He studied at The United States School of Professional Paperhanging in Rutland, Vermont in 1984. Here he learned the fine art of hanging materials like fabrics, silks, screen print papers, and murals, receiving the highest of marks. He has maintained a faithful residential clientele in the South Jersey area ever since. He also has done many out-of-the-ordinary projects like working on unique hotels, large industrial plants, and popular commercial buildings. A most memorable job for him was working in an exquisite apartment overlooking Central Park where he was asked to hang a one-of-a-kind silk mural made in Japan specifically for the project. While he spent much of his career working as a reputable one-man operation, Doug has proudly modernized and expanded the family business over the last decade or so. He and his loving wife, Kathy, have three grown children, along with eight little grandchildren who affectionately refer to him as “Pipa”.
Doug (aka “Junior”) began learning the tricks of the trade at the young age of seven where he stripped wallpaper with his dad. As he grew, he gladly assisted with painting projects during the summer, picking up on the detail-oriented ways of his father and The Painting & Wallcovering Company. Along with family-learned skills, Doug also possesses the innate determination of a distinguished athlete. The discipline and lessons learned during his 20+ years of wrestling fuels him toward greatness in all of his endeavors. In 2009, he became an All-American, taking 3rd at NCAA’s and graduating from Rider University with a BSBA in Finance. He spent the next few years living and training in PA under Olympic Gold Medalist, Cael Sanderson. In 2012, he returned to NJ to officially become part of the family business. He’s proud of what he and his dad have accomplished together and has since established a complimentary business called, The Remodeling Company. Here he enjoys more carpentry-focused projects and the ability to create. Doug lives in Shamong, NJ with his beautiful wife and six young children.
